Transaction 76e92705c9a0d5bf81bc523653cea5b1d9eb2073154756559708024aae718665
1 Input
2 Outputs
- 76e92705c9a0d5bf81bc523653cea5b1d9eb2073154756559708024aae718665:0
- 76e92705c9a0d5bf81bc523653cea5b1d9eb2073154756559708024aae718665:1
value 2411874
address 1AnYUQhRcepnSKwAvdQ2pJpz6vVUbiphMc
value 5612854
address 3PeVyCZ3PXgEmJqgAJr7NiPPMA4jtjN5Rh